Transaction 56382a6bc8917cae5036a99d8944454b0c89e486092eea58b95e909772f73abd
1 Input
1 Output
-
56382a6bc8917cae5036a99d8944454b0c89e486092eea58b95e909772f73abd:0
- value
- 433596
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e85307d9e925dc877ddbf16ea5b338450faefa0
- address
- bc1qd6znqlv7jfwusa7ahutw5kens3g04maq7frc3z